Cancer prevalence, incidence, and mortality rates in Afghanistan in 2020: A review study.

Nasar Ahmad ShayanAli RahimiLütfiye Hilal Özcebe
Published in: Cancer reports (Hoboken, N.J.) (2023)
This study provides a brief overview of the general cancer situation in Afghanistan, and a more in-depth analysis of the five common cancers identified. Effective therapies, awareness, and prevention initiatives targeting lifestyle, immunization, early diagnosis, and environmental risk factors are essential for addressing the impact of population growth and aging on cancer incidence in Afghanistan. Further research and extensive studies are needed to better understand cancer burden in the country.
